Core Services Provided by Sharjah Audit Professionals

Financial auditing is the primary function of these specialized firms. They examine financial statements to ensure accuracy and adherence to International Financial Reporting Standards (IFRS). This process involves a systematic review of transactions, assets, and liabilities to verify that the reported figures represent the true financial health of the entity.

Beyond statutory audits, these firms provide internal auditing services. This involves an objective evaluation of a company’s internal controls, corporate governance, and accounting processes. By identifying weaknesses in the system, internal auditors help prevent fraud and improve resource allocation. This proactive approach allows business owners to rectify issues before they escalate into significant financial losses or legal complications.

Importance of Statutory Audits for Mainland and Free Zone Entities

Entities operating within Sharjah Mainland or Free Zones like SAIF Zone and Hamriyah Free Zone are legally required to submit audited financial statements. These reports are essential for renewing trade licenses and maintaining good standing with government authorities.

Free zone authorities often have specific lists of approved auditors. Engaging a firm that is officially registered with these jurisdictions ensures that your audit reports are accepted without delay. Furthermore, banks and financial institutions in the UAE require audited statements to evaluate creditworthiness for business loans or credit facilities. Without a professionally audited report, securing capital for expansion becomes significantly more difficult.

Navigating UAE Corporate Tax Compliance

The introduction of corporate tax has shifted the focus of financial reporting in the UAE. Businesses must now ensure their accounting practices align with the specific requirements of the Federal Tax Authority (FTA). Expert auditors assist in calculating taxable income, identifying deductible expenses, and ensuring that tax returns are filed accurately and on time.

Professional firms help businesses understand the nuances of the tax law, such as the treatment of capital gains, dividends, and intra-group transactions. This guidance is vital for avoiding heavy penalties associated with non-compliance. By maintaining a clear audit trail throughout the year, companies can simplify the tax filing process and ensure they are taking advantage of all available exemptions and reliefs.

Significance of VAT Consultancy and Compliance

Value Added Tax (VAT) remains a critical component of the UAE’s fiscal policy. Audit firms provide comprehensive VAT services, including registration, return filing, and representation during FTA audits. They ensure that businesses correctly calculate input and output tax to avoid overpayment or underpayment.

Errors in VAT reporting can lead to substantial fines. Professional consultants review transactions to ensure correct tax treatment and help businesses implement robust VAT accounting systems. This specialized knowledge is particularly beneficial for companies involved in international trade or complex supply chains where VAT implications can be intricate.

Business Valuation and Due Diligence for Mergers

When a business looks to expand through acquisitions or seek new investors, accurate valuation is crucial. Auditors use various methodologies, such as discounted cash flow and market multiples, to determine the fair value of an entity. This objective assessment forms the basis for negotiations and investment decisions.

Due diligence involves a thorough investigation into the financial, legal, and operational aspects of a target company. Audit firms conduct this scrutiny to identify hidden liabilities, verify asset ownership, and assess the sustainability of future earnings. This rigorous process protects investors from making uninformed decisions and ensures that the terms of the deal are fair.

Liquidation and Insolvency Services

In cases where a business must close its operations, audit firms act as liquidators to oversee the winding-up process. They ensure that all assets are realized, liabilities are settled, and the remaining proceeds are distributed to shareholders in accordance with the law.

Liquidation requires strict adherence to legal procedures, including notifying creditors and de-registering the company from various government departments. Professional liquidators manage these complexities, ensuring a smooth and legally compliant exit. This service is essential for protecting the directors from personal liability and ensuring that the closure is handled with professionalism.

Technology Integration in Modern Auditing

The auditing profession is increasingly leveraging technology to improve accuracy and efficiency. Data analytics tools allow auditors to test 100% of a company’s transactions rather than relying on traditional sampling methods. This provides a higher level of assurance and helps identify patterns that might indicate fraud or operational inefficiencies.

Cloud-based accounting systems enable real-time collaboration between the business and the auditor. This transparency allows for continuous monitoring of financial health and quicker response times to potential issues. Audit firms that embrace these technological advancements provide more value-added services, helping businesses stay ahead in a digital-first economy.

Preparing for a Successful Audit Cycle

A successful audit starts with thorough preparation. Businesses should maintain organized records, including bank statements, invoices, contracts, and payroll data, throughout the year. Reconciling accounts on a monthly basis helps identify and resolve discrepancies early, preventing delays during the final audit.

Open communication with the auditor is also key. Discussing significant transactions or changes in the business model before the audit begins allows the auditor to plan their procedures effectively. Providing the necessary documentation promptly and being available to answer queries ensures that the audit is completed within the required timeframe.
